Auckland seeded sixth

NZPA Hong Kong Auckland has been seeded sixth of the 20 teams taking part in next, month’s international seven-a-side rugby tournament in Hong Kong. The organisers have ranked last year’s winner, Fiji, as the top team and then rate, in order, the Scottish Co-optiniists, the British Barbarians, Australia, the Argentinian Pumas, Auckland, Japan and South Korea.

The Barbarians and the Pumas will be taking part in the competition for the first time.

At the five previous seven-a-side tournaments in Hong Kong, the team representing - New Zealand has never failed to reach at least the semi-finals. Cantabrians won the initial tournament in 1976 and Marlborough and Manawatu. were the beaten finalists in 1977 and 1978 respectively.

Manawatu, again • representing New Zealand, lost in the semi-finals at the 1979 and 1980 tournaments. This year’s tournament, to be played: on March 28 and 29, has been divided . into four groups of five teams. The top four teams have been placed in separate groups, and the other . four seeds — including Auckland — will be drawn so that each group- has two of the eight seeds. The draw will be made next week.

Each group will play a round-robin (four games each), the top two going through to the quarter-finals of the championships. The third and fourth teams will take part in the plate event and the bottom team in each group will be eliminated from the tournament.
